How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Babbitt?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Babbitt Studio Apartments | $1,171 | $585 | $1,720 |
Babbitt 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,280 | $700 | $2,441 |
| Babbitt 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,824 | $750 | $4,081 |
| Babbitt 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,379 | $1,290 | $3,899 |

Largest Available Babbitt and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Babbitt, MN is found at ENDI Plaza in the Congdon neighborhood and is 880 square feet priced from $2,441. Ridgewood Apartments in the Duluth Heights neighborhood has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 860 square feet and currently listed start at $1,450.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Babbitt: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| ENDI Plaza | Huron Island | 880 Sq Ft | $2,441 |
| Ridgewood Apartments |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| 860 Sq Ft | $1,450 |
| Highland Village Apartments | 1BR KNOLL | 765 Sq Ft | $1,199 |
| Kenwood Village | 1 Bedroom + 1 Bath | 716 Sq Ft | $1,495 |
| 5739 Marble Ave | 1 Bedroom | 700 Sq Ft | $760 |
Cheapest Available Babbitt and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of January 15,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Babbitt, MN is the 1 Bdr-Market Rate Model starting from $700 at Meadowview Apartments . The second most affordable Babbitt 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om 1 Bath Model at Mountain Manor Apartments starting at $701 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Babbitt is currently $1,280.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Babbitt: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Meadowview Apartments | 1 Bdr-Market Rate | $700 |
| Mountain Manor Apartments | 1 Bedroom 1 Bath | $701 |
| 5739 Marble Ave | 1 Bedroom | $760 |
| Ivy Manor Apartments | 1 Bedroom | $800 |
| Highland Village Apartments | 1BR KNOLL | $1,199 |
